it是做什么的?

it是关于计算机、互联网、通信等领域的工作 ,主要是做软件类、硬件类、网络类、信息系统类、制造类。


it指信息技术

全称为Internet Technology。是主要用于管理和处理信息所采用的各种技术的总称。

它主要是应用计算机科学和通信技术来设计、开发、安装和实施信息系统及应用软件。

it行业也是一个比较广泛的行业,在上面我们了解什么是it,其中也说到主要包括计算机以及网络通信等领域,所以IT行业就是主要以电脑或者以通讯为主的行业,比如互联网公司、软硬件开发以及手机通讯公司以及it产品服务的工作均可成为IT行业。
 

it有三种含义,分别指硬件、软件和应用,硬件了主要指数据传输,处理和传输的主机和网络通信设备;软件指可用来搜集,存储,检索,分析,应用,评估信息的各种软件;应用指搜集、存储、检索、分析、应用、评估使用各种信息。

it在计算机技术的基础上开发建立的一种信息技术,互联网技术通过计算机网络的广域网使不同的设备相互连接,加快信息的传输速度和拓宽信息的获取渠道,促进各种不同的软件应用的开发,改变了人们的生活和学习方式。
IT行业工作岗位及工作内容介绍:

UI设计

5ca2b5d68bb2406ca8d61d82bb2de02a.jpg

 UI设计,即用户界面,是指对软件的人机交互、操作逻辑、界面美观的整体设计。APP软件、电脑软件上的图标设计、交互设计等都属于UI设计。UI设计按照所用界面来分,可以分为移动端UI设计、PC端UI设计、游戏UI设计以及其他UI设计。

UI的发展前景是很赞的,在两到三年前,甚至都有人推动让UI来代替产品经理来驱动。某种程度上来说,UI最好的发展方向是UE,也就是交互,然后就是用户体验优化师。

WEB前端

e52896638d2549e7a561d37b77de684f.jpg

 

前端开发是创建Web页面或app等前端界面呈现du给用户的过程,zhi通过HTML,CSS及JavaScript以及衍生出来的各种技术、框架、解决方案,来实现互联网产品的用户界面交互。

CSS工程师要考虑更多的就是兼容性。一般来说,CSS工程师并不存在,写CSS的人最好要掌握JS代码、Html5。这是前端人员必备技能。


后端开发

b466a300fc7a4d95bcef1e40e0b518f0.jpg

 

做后端开发与前端开发不同的是,他们写的代码大多是用户不会直接使用到的代码,也就是非用户接口代码。比如:逻辑判断、数据库等等。后端的工程师目前使用最多的就是Java,所以最热门的后端岗位也就是Java工程师。

后端语言包括Java、PHP和Python等。后端的发展前景很大,无论是B/S还是C/S,无论是WEB还是原生,或者是智能硬件,后端都会屹立不倒。


硬件工程师

94a5e31802d345829e066c253bf8570b.png硬件工程师要求熟悉计算机市场行情;主要工作为:制定计算机组装计划、选购组装需要的硬件设备、合理配置和安装计算机以及外围设备、安装和配置计算机软件系统等。

 

硬件测试工程师a583c91be2c048a7a33d6b57b7dfa509.webp

主要负责硬件产品的测试工作,保证测试质量及测试工作的顺利进行;编写测试计划、测试用例;提交测试报告,撰写用户说明书;参与硬件测试技术和规范的改进和制定。软件测试是互联网产品的质检师,当一个APP、网站或者小程序等形式的互联网产品完成后,需要给软件测试工程师测试,在用户使用之前发现产品存在的问题。比如微信APP有Android和iOS两种客户端,每部手机的显示大小,及系统型号都不同。同一个软件要在各种用户系统里顺利运行出现一些bug。软件测试就是要发现这些Bug,提交给UI、前端、后端工程师去解决。

 

网络营销师ceca996e28524afc9a98c798e5f02964.png

网络营销师是中国互联网行业兴起后产生的一个新型职业。他们负责将互联网技术与市场营销相结合,通过各种技术手段与营销推广方式相结合,提高网站的访问量和知名度,为企业提供网络营销规划、网站建设规划、搜索引擎优化(SEO)、内容营销设计、网络活动策划、网络团队管理、软文营销策划等工作。网络营销师是引进流量、提升销售、建设网络品牌的人,实现传播与销售的双重功能。

产品经理593d5644621e42f3b9fc1aebe275ece2.jpg

产品经理负责产品制定需求和功能,并通过市场调研、用户调研、竞对调研等,了解市场上的社交软件需求和竞争对手的软件功能,将功能需求汇集成需求文档,提交给设计师,并最终确定产品的设计方向和目标。

信息传递中介行业b4e784a9508c41e498e75b7594919d6f.jpg

信息传递中介行业包括印刷业、出版业、新闻广播业、通讯邮电业、广告业等。它们利用现代化的信息传递中介手段,将信息及时、准确、完整地传递到目标地点。此外,信息传递中介行业也可分为一次信息产业和二次信息产业,前者包括传统的传递信息情报的商品与服务手段,后者则为政府、企业及个人等提供内部消费者服务。信息传递中介行业在现代信息处理和传播方面起着重要的作用。

云计算198fb013e70143e59d3e541dee2e75d4.png

云计算的发展方向多样化,有虚拟化工程师,运维工程师等。本来运维的工作要被后端工程师蚕食了(后端工程师真是一个可怕的职业,可以这么说,没有后端工程师做不了的包括产品,市场和运营)然而随着云的发展, 运维工程师简直是有了新生。就拿虚拟化工程师和运维工程师的薪资来说云在未来的发展趋势将会一直持续上升。

大数据工程师fa60738faa0d45069c3ab0e74d3747a5.png

环境【Linux】,框架【Hadoo,spark,storm,pig,hive,mahout,zookeeper 】,算法【mapreduce,hdfs,zookeeper】这些框架的原理和实现都要了解的比较清楚。这才算是一个合格的大数据工程师。大数据工程师负责对大量数据进行分布式处理,以实现数据的有效利用和挖掘。他们主要使用Hadoop等可靠高效的数据处理框架,以及相关开发、建设、测试和维护工具平台。大数据工程师的工作涵盖各个领域,如开发、建设、测试和维护等。他们需要具备扎实的算法和数据科学的知识和技能,才能胜任大数据平台相关的工作。薪资根据不同地区和工作经验而有所不同,一般在10k~30k之间。

运营01c31c3426394bdd8405df265626fe73.jpg

运营,产品,技术是创业团队的三大主心骨,这从侧面也显示出来了运营同学的重要性。什么活动,渠道,品牌,内容,数据分析、用户运营等等,都是运营的范畴。

技术支持工程师

80646997b0354e68aeae506e02533245.jpg

 技术支持工程师负责提供技术支持和故障排除服务,帮助客户解决计算机硬件和软件问题。他们可以在售前和售后阶段提供技术支持,包括帮助销售团队了解产品使用和故障处理,提供用户培训和指导,以及处理用户的投诉和纠纷。技术支持工程师是技术团队中的关键成员,他们通过专业的技术知识和经验,为企业和客户提供高质量的技术支持。

Java开发bf8b8f0b35e445d6a77abfe291529ecb.jpg

Java开发主要应用于企业级应用开发、游戏开发和网站开发等领域。

服务器状态确认

服务器状态确认是维护服务器健康状况的重要工作,每天需要查看系统上运行着的应用程序或数据库状态是否正常。

服务器调优96c69621004d4af8931703ce03e144cb.jpg

服务器调优是为了保证系统处于最佳状态,通过对操作系统及数据库进行性能调优,可以提升系统的运行效率和可靠性。

操作系统故障排除dcd02d4064bf4c3fb4f224848dd32fbf.webp

操作系统故障排除是为了保证操作系统的高可用性,通过分析出现的问题并采取相应的措施来解决问题。这样可以避免操作系统出现不可用的错误,保证系统的稳定性和正常运行。

数据挖掘工程师d93d4f67702a478e85faa45edc0b50e9.jpg

数据挖掘工程师是负责数据挖掘和分析的专业人员,通过分析数据并从中找到规律,为决策者提供最佳决策支持。他们主要使用人工智能、机器学习、模式识别、统计学、数据库、可视化技术等手段,自动化地分析企业的数据,从中挖掘出潜在的模式,帮助决策者调整市场策略,减少风险,做出正确的决策。

信息处理和服务产业

信息处理和服务产业利用现代的电子计算机系统收集、加工、整理、储存信息,为各行业提供各种信息服务。例如,计算机中心、信息中心和咨询公司等。

高新区宿舍服务器管理、维护及保养

高新区宿舍服务器管理、维护及保养工作旨在保障宿舍楼宇的正常运行和居民的住宿需求。具体工作内容包括安装、调试设备,制定维护计划,进行维修保养,确保宿舍设施的及时更新和维护。

 

it行业的发展前景

第一:物联网领域。随着5G标准的落地,物联网领域将迎来巨大的发展机遇,尤其是车联网、农业物联网、可穿戴设备等领域将逐步打破已有的场景限制,进一步促进相关产品的落地应用,也会由此创造出大量的就业机会。

第二:人工智能领域。物联网的发展会促进大数据领域的发展,而大数据的发展会进一步促进人工智能领域的发展,万物互联必然会带来万物智能。从这个角度来看,未来人工智能领域的发展前景也非常广阔。目前人工智能领域尤其是机器学习(包括深度学习)、自然语言处理和计算机视觉等方向都取得了一定的发展,不少人工智能产品也开始陆续应用到生产环境中,未来人工智能领域的市场发展空间将十分巨大,同样会释放出大量的就业机会。

第三:产业互联网。当前正处在产业互联网发展的初期,目前不少大型科技公司(互联网公司)也开始陆续布局产业互联网领域。产业互联网的目标是进一步融合到传统行业中,为传统行业的发展赋能,这个过程将进一步促进传统行业的结构化升级,而结构化升级的背后必然是人才结构的升级,所以对于掌握物联网、大数据、人工智能等技术的年轻人来说,产业互联网提供了新的发展舞台。

 

 

  • 23
    点赞
  • 20
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
### 回答1: QApplication是Qt中的一个类,它提供了一个应用程序的框架。它主要用于初始化和管理应用程序的各种组件,例如窗口、菜单、工具栏等。它还提供了一些全局的属性和方法,例如应用程序的名称、图标等,可以方便地在应用程序的各个部分中进行访问。另外,QApplication还负责处理应用程序的事件循环,这是Qt中实现事件驱动的核心机制。 ### 回答2: QApplication是Qt框架中的一个类,用于创建和管理应用程序的主事件循环。它是一个全局对象,用于处理用户输入、处理窗口事件、管理应用程序的行为等。 QApplication主要用于以下几个方面: 1. 提供主事件循环:QApplication负责处理用户的各种输入事件,例如鼠标点击、键盘按下等,通过主事件循环将这些事件传递给应用程序的其他对象进行处理。 2. 管理窗口事件:QApplication可以接收并处理与窗口相关的事件,例如窗口的打开、关闭、最小化、最大化等。通过QApplication,我们可以监听页面事件,并根据需要出相应的处理。 3. 处理命令行参数:QApplication可以解析命令行参数,并提供相关的接口以便应用程序使用。这样,我们可以通过命令行来控制应用程序的行为,例如传递不同的参数来启动应用程序的不同模式。 4. 管理应用程序行为:QApplication提供了一些接口用于管理应用程序的行为,例如设置应用程序的名称、图标,设置默认的字体、样式等。我们可以通过这些接口来定制应用程序的外观和行为。 总之,QApplication是Qt中用于创建和管理应用程序的主事件循环的类,它提供了丰富的功能,用于处理用户输入、窗口事件、命令行参数以及定制应用程序的行为。 ### 回答3: QApplication是Qt框架中的一个类,用于创建和管理应用程序的主事件循环以及处理用户输入和系统消息。它是整个Qt应用程序的核心部分。 QApplication类提供了许多方法和功能,使开发人员可以方便地创建跨平台的图形用户界面(GUI)应用程序。具体而言,QApplication可以用于以下方面: 1. 管理应用程序的事件循环:QApplication负责处理用户操作、系统消息和事件,并将它们传递给相应的控件进行处理。它使得开发人员可以方便地定义和处理应用程序中的各种事件。 2. 提供应用程序级别的设置和配置:QApplication可以根据应用程序的需要设置和配置各种参数,例如应用程序的名称、图标、窗口大小等。 3. 处理应用程序的启动和退出:QApplication提供了启动和退出应用程序的方法,可以通过它来启动应用程序并在适当的时候退出应用程序。 4. 窗口管理和布局:QApplication可以创建和管理应用程序的窗口,并提供了丰富的布局和窗口管理功能,使开发人员可以方便地设计和组织应用程序的用户界面。 5. 处理命令行参数:QApplication支持解析命令行参数,并将其传递给应用程序进行处理。这使得开发人员可以根据命令行参数来调整应用程序的行为。 总之,QApplication是Qt框架中用于创建和管理图形用户界面应用程序的核心类,提供了许多功能和方法,使开发人员可以方便地创建跨平台的GUI应用程序,并处理用户输入、系统消息和应用程序级别的设置。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值